Transaction 11323ae31ca1f495c6322e5efdf727cb773330e338cfd43915f2693f34975f56

1 Input
2 Outputs
  • 11323ae31ca1f495c6322e5efdf727cb773330e338cfd43915f2693f34975f56:0
  • value  2666444
    address  32DZzfV5HLQUecpoL8ZSVDHCsSj8cdUaSJ
  • 11323ae31ca1f495c6322e5efdf727cb773330e338cfd43915f2693f34975f56:1
  • value  470229368
    address  3LezqyJekUDUgrxY7VHEkBht9w3LRQuqJB